- Luggage and Equipment Can Be Planned in Advance
Business travelers sometimes carry more than one suitcase.
A team may arrive with:
- Presentation materials
- Event equipment
- Product samples
- Trade-show materials
- Multiple suitcases
- Carry-on bags
Passenger count alone may therefore be misleading.
Five passengers may technically fit into one vehicle, but five passengers plus substantial luggage may not.
With private transportation, these requirements can be discussed before the trip.
When booking, provide specific luggage and equipment information rather than saying only:
“We have four people.”
That reduces surprises at pickup.

Private Transportation vs Rideshare for Business Travel
Rideshare and private transportation both have legitimate uses.
Rideshare May Be Better When:
- The trip is casual
- Plans are flexible
- You need an unplanned ride
- Budget is the primary concern
- The journey is short and straightforward
Private Transportation May Be Better When:
- The meeting is important
- The trip is scheduled
- You’re transporting clients
- Several stops are involved
- You need airport coordination
- Professional presentation matters
- You need vehicle planning
- A group is traveling together
Many corporate travelers use both.
The key is deciding which trips are important enough to justify more advance planning.

Point-to-Point vs Hourly Corporate Transportation
Understanding the difference can help companies control both costs and logistics.
Point-to-Point Transportation
Best suited to:
Pickup → Destination
Examples:
- Airport to hotel
- Hotel to meeting
- Office to airport
Hourly Transportation
Better suited to:
Pickup → Stop → Stop → Stop → Final Destination
The right option depends on your itinerary.
Do not automatically book hourly service when one transfer is enough, and do not book several individual rides when your schedule clearly requires continuous transportation.
